In 1840 more than 500 chiefs signed the Treaty of Waitangi, New Zealand’s founding document. Ngā Tohu, when complete, will contain a biographical sketch of each signatory.

Tahanui signed the Cook Strait (Henry Williams) sheet of the Treaty of Waitangi on 11 May 1840 at Rangitoto (D’Urville Island).
